Understanding the Significance of Christ's Blood
Right off the bat, let's get one thing straight: Christ's blood is not just any blood. It's the blood of the Son of God, shed on the cross as a sacrifice for the sins of humanity. This act of sacrifice is at the very core of the Christian faith. The blood of Jesus represents the ultimate act of love, mercy, and redemption. It washes away our sins and allows us to have a relationship with God. In the Old Testament, the shedding of blood was necessary for the forgiveness of sins. Animals were sacrificed as a temporary atonement. But Jesus, being the perfect and sinless Son of God, offered Himself as the ultimate sacrifice, once and for all. His blood became the perfect atonement for all sins, past, present, and future. It's a pretty heavy concept, right? But the implications are powerful. When we accept Jesus as our savior, we are covered by His blood. Our sins are forgiven, and we are made clean in God's eyes. It's like receiving a fresh start, a clean slate.
Think about it: Christ's blood is the key to our salvation. The Bible says, “For God so loved the world that he gave his one and only Son, that whoever believes in him shall not perish but have eternal life” (John 3:16). This eternal life is made possible through the sacrifice of Jesus and the shedding of His blood. When we trust in Jesus and believe that His blood paid the price for our sins, we receive eternal life. We are reconciled to God, and we have the promise of spending eternity with Him. The Cleansing Power of the Blood
Okay, let's get into the nitty-gritty: the cleansing power of the blood. The Bible talks about how Jesus' blood cleanses us from all sin. It's not just about covering up our mistakes; it's about a complete and total cleansing. When we confess our sins and ask for forgiveness, the blood of Jesus washes us clean, removing all the guilt and shame that comes with sin. This cleansing power has a really, really powerful impact on our lives. First off, it brings about forgiveness. When we are forgiven, we no longer have to carry the weight of our sins. The burden is lifted, and we can experience freedom and joy. The Bible says, “If we confess our sins, he is faithful and just and will forgive us our sins and purify us from all unrighteousness” (1 John 1:9). This forgiveness is a gift that we receive through the blood of Jesus. It's freely offered to anyone who believes. Next, this cleansing brings about reconciliation with God. Sin separates us from God, but the blood of Jesus bridges that gap. It makes a way for us to have a personal relationship with Him. The Blood in the Context of Salvation
Alright, let's talk about how the blood of Jesus fits into our salvation. As we mentioned earlier, salvation is the process of being saved from sin and its consequences. The Bible teaches that we are saved by grace through faith. Jesus, through his death and resurrection, secured salvation for all who believe in him. When we trust in Jesus as our Lord and Savior, we receive the gift of salvation, and that is what the blood is all about. The blood is the very foundation of this gift! Think of it like this: the blood of Jesus paid the price for our sins. It satisfied God's justice and made it possible for us to be forgiven. Because of the blood, God can offer us His grace and mercy. When we accept Jesus, we are covered by His blood. Our sins are forgiven, and we are declared righteous in God's eyes.
